#76401e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#76401e is composed of 46.3% red, 25.1%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.8% magenta, 74.6%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 23.2 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 29%. #76401e color hex could be obtained by blending #ec803c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#76401e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090502 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#76401e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4946 is the less saturated color, while #923a02 is the most saturated one.
